Dubai Yellow Pages Online
CASTLE REFRIGERATION EQUIPMENT TRADING (L.L.C.)

CASTLE REFRIGERATION EQUIPMENT TRADING (L.L.C.) - | E-Showroom

Home » Catalogue
Products Catalogue